Output 66bfd2012259f016f1df62003c48b3401a5a6ce927ce6f60fcfa9a239bc7b99c:1

value
80223756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8b9fa797655a1f15d8d8ca8b77589aee6d31167 OP_EQUAL
address
3JXm3r6z96XQ3jnsmvte3rXMExZwLPFt21
transaction
66bfd2012259f016f1df62003c48b3401a5a6ce927ce6f60fcfa9a239bc7b99c
spent
true